Body
Education
Alexandra Gavryushkina was educated at University of Auckland[3]. Doctoral advisors include Alexei Drummond[4], a researcher[12], b. 2000[13], awarded the Fellow of the Royal Society Te Apārangi[14], specialised in bioinformatics[15] and David Welch[5], a researcher[16]. They earned the academic degree of Doctor of Philosophy[8].
